Web28 Dec 2016 · Now that we’ve covered the basics, let’s look at 5 benefits story maps provide. 1. Make prioritization and identification of the MVP easier. Prioritization is reflected on the story map’s y-axis and critical stories move up towards the top. To deliver quickly and get user feedback as early as possible, it’s critical to identify the MVP.

WebIn 2005, Jeff Patton introduced the first Story Maps. The main idea behind them was to manage and prioritize work that needed to be done in an organized and efficient way. For that, a richer structure was necessary and single-list product backlogs turned out to be an outdated technique.
